OSC (2006) – Ulf Langheinrich

 

OSC is an installation dealing with interference, slicing time and the perception of time itself that tests the senses of the viewer. Interference and stroboscopic patterns give a new dimension to the perception and experience of time. The audiovisual overload of OSC sheds light on the question how our sensory apparatus constructs meaningful experiences from information without reference.

 

Ulf Langheinrich (D) founded the media art collaboration Granular Synthesis together with Kurt Hentschläger. They collaborated on numerous large scale immersive installations such as Modell5, Noisegate and Areal. Since 2003 Langheinrich has realised several solo projects aimed at achieving a direct sensory impact. They focus on creating specific modulations of the projected material in time and in the projection-space, and effecting interference movements between the perceptive and processing potential of the eye-brain-apparatus.
